Green Head WA.

Well we left the town of Leeman and heading South to the next town that we explored the town of Green Head.

Green Head has a lobster fishing fleet, this industry started in the 1950s and still currently running off the coast.

Green Head is a small coastal fishing village. We drove through part of the town and headed down to the hetty to see the Indian Ocean off its coastline. The water turquoise in color, seaweed and sand made the seabed off the jetty. Photo opportunity again this place is beautiful but there was a smell from some decomposing seaweed. 

You could see the waves breaking on a shallow reef a far way out. The rock area on the coastline was also picturesque.

As we were trying to drive out we saw a sign saying lookout, had to check it out. Driving up a very steep hill we entered a gravel driveway to the lookout. A seating area on top and views as far as the eye can see. This is a sweet spot to grab a glass of wine and watch the sunset. For us it was to early in the day.
South of Green Head is Fishermen Islands which is breeding ground for sea lions, which you can book tours to see. Another area we discovered was Dynamite Bay, a beautiful secluded cove and parks with shelters, manicured lawns toilet block, walk trails. This is also photo opportunity.
The town of Green Head is between Leeman and Jurien Bay. Well onto the next town of Jurien Bay.
